Effective Methods For Dealing With Acne
Acne is one of the most common types of skin disorders that affects millions of teenagers the world over. It is estimated that over 75% of all teens are affected by acne to some degree. Although there has been a lot of research done on acne, there is still no conclusive medical theory as to what exactly causes it. It is generally thought that the oil glands located on the face become over-active and clog the pores of the skin which cause the unsightly breakouts.
There are many types of acne treatment methods that can be used to curtail the spread of acne and to reduce the inflammation and redness. Most drugstores carry a variety of acne medicines that contain benzoyl peroxide. The peroxide kills the bacteria that is associated with acne and helps to dry up the area. There are also preparations that contain sulphur which is proven to be very effective in the treatment of acne. Much like the benzoyl peroxide, the creams, gels and lotions containing sulphur attacks the bacteria and dries the oozing sores that aide in reducing the infected areas of the skin.
These types of over-the-counter acne products should help to clear up acne within two or three weeks if used on a regular basis. They are completely safe to use and do not have any negative side effects associated with them. For severe cases of acne, it is best to visit a dermatologist who may want to prescribe tetracycline. This is a commonly used drug that is considered to be safe to use over long periods of time.
Most people with acne search for the best acne treatment that is available without a doctor's prescription. There are some great natural treatments available that are said to be very effective in treating acne. These products make use of such things like green tea, aloe vera, sage extract or gotu kola-which are all plant derivatives that help to improve skin healing.
The most important aspect of obtaining clear skin is using a good topical regime. Many experts advise acne sufferers to look for the products that use several active ingredients, which will deliver quicker results and help to minimize skin irritation. For example, look for the products that combine benzoyl peroxide with things like salicyclic acid that is known to unclog pores.
Be sure to read the labels carefully when shopping for acne medicine. Nearly all of the top creams and gels contain peroxide as it is considered to be the best topical agent in the fight against acne, so be sure the product you choose contains this essential ingredient.
